Cardrona and Treble Cone have a long history of providing quality training and facilities to support young snow sports athletes along their competitive pathways.

Our mission is to provide a world class training programme that gives our athletes the opportunity to excel in snow sports in New Zealand and at an international level.  
We aim to create a seamless progression between junior development and high performance, providing passionate young athletes the platform for success and opportunity by:

- Providing opportunities and facilities for athletes to grow from rookie to pro.

- Supporting our athletes to develop the tools to face challenges and achieve goals.

- Actively preparing athletes for ownership and accountability of their own performance.

- Creating a team culture and camaraderie in which every individual thrives.

Our High-Performance Centre (HPC) encompasses all our competitive training programmes across both Cardrona and Treble Cone and includes - Cardrona Parks Squad, Wanaka Ski Team, TC Freeride Team, and Coaches Apprentice.

With an emphasis on the fundamentals, WST strives to create an environment that is fun, supportive, and conducive to learning. The ultimate goal of the program is to develop resilient athletes who are achieving their ski racing potential.  The Wanaka Ski Team has full and part-time programmes for junior skiers at the beginning of their race journey all the way through to FIS level athletes.

The Cardrona Parks Squad calls the Southern Hemisphere's most extensive terrain parks and pipes their home. Cardrona is home to four progressive terrain parks for all levels of freestylers, two halfpipes, a big air jump and a gravity-x course. The Cardrona Parks Squad coaches are some of the best in the game and will help athletes on a competition pathway learn new tricks and iron out kinks in their style.

The TC Freeride Team trains on some of New Zealand's best freeride terrain at Treble Cone. TC's natural bowls, halfpipes, chutes, cliffs, steeps and side hits make it the ideal training ground for young freeride athletes. The team will help athletes progress their skiing and mentor them through local freeride competitions.

The Coach Apprentice Certificate Program at Cardrona is built on a mission to provide education for ski and snowboarding coaches. By instilling coaches with the necessary skills, knowledge, and resources, the program aims to create sustainable coaching.

Athlete Homestay

The Cardrona Parks Squad offers Homestay placements for freeski & snowboard athletes.

Coming to New Zealand for a season of training with the Cardrona Parks Squad can be a significant commitment for an entire family. Our team can connect you with a local Wanaka family who are happy to house your young athlete for the winter season in our Homestay programme. We can provide an ideal environment for training and suggest the the athletes are above 14 years of age.

Homestay families provide your athlete with a warm, supportive home for the winter, with all their meals included in the agreed weekly payment between you & the host family. Weekly payments range from $300 - $360 per week depending on living situation & home facilities.

ATHLETE HOMESTAY INFORMATION

For athletes wanting a home away from home while they train, our Cardrona High Performance Centre programme coordinator can put you in touch with a friendly, local Wanaka family who enjoy having a new family member over the winter months. They offer a caring family environment, support and home cooking after a day of training and study.

We believe that the relationships created in a homestay environment can be life long and we encourage athletes’ families to keep in regular contact with their child and the homestay family before and during their stay.

We have a limited number of homestay families available, so please apply no later than 4 weeks before the start of your training and we will try to arrange a suitable match for you.

IMPORTANT HOMESTAY INFORMATION

Before you apply for a homestay position at the bottom of this page, here is some important information:

Training requirements

To be eligible for homestay you must be registered in full-time HPC coaching.

Ideal homestay location

  • Close to Wanaka town centre for ProActive gym sessions, town centre transport pickups, and dryland/social activities
  • Walking distance if possible

Ideal bedroom situation

  • Own room
  • Bed and all linen
  • Reasonable storage for clothes etc

Meals

  • Help yourself breakfast
  • Packed lunch
  • Home-cooked meal in the evening. If your family goes out for dinner they must include you in their arrangements and pay for your evening meal. If it is not suitable for you to be present at the family’s arrangement, then an alternative meal must be provided. If you want to go out with friends, any meals will be at your expense

Transport

  • You are responsible for organising transport to and from training venues and any venue at which you are studying outside of training
  • If homestay family is asked to provide transport on a one-off or on regular occasions, additional compensation and limitations will need to be agreed on by you and your homestay family

Training

  • HPC will advise details of training and any events to the homestay family using Facebook, Twitter and email as per info pack
  • If you are sick, please contact HPC and your coach
  • Your coach will maintain regular contact with you regarding your training commitments

Internet

  • Not all households have broadband and internet services can be expensive, so if your family agrees to allow you access to their internet, please respect any guidelines (for example, they may only allow email checking, no downloads)

Heating and electricity

  • Most New Zealand houses do not have central heating and either use log burner fires or electric heating for warmth. Local families pay an electricity bill per month based on the amount of usage. Although we want you to be warm and comfortable, we request that you be sensible and considerate with your usage of heating and electricity

Emergencies

  • If you need medical attention, your homestay family should take you to their doctor or nearest medical centre
  • In any type of emergency, please contact the Homestay Coordinator and advise the situation as per the contact details provided

Homestay payments

  • Payments are required to go directly to the homestay family as arranged prior to arrival. HPC is not responsible for any payments or exchange of money

IMPORTANT INFORMATION

Before you apply to be a host family for the winter season at the bottom of this page, here's some important info:

Ideal family location

  • Close to Wanaka town centre for gym sessions, town centre transport pick-ups & dry land/social activities
  • Walking distance if possible
  • Athlete may be enrolled in MAC or language centre for tuition.

Ideal bedroom situation

  • Own room
  • Bed & all linen
  • Reasonable storage for clothes etc

Meals

Good nutrition is an important part of an HPC athlete's training. They have healthy appetites as they train hard all day & burn a lot of energy which needs to be replaced.

Required meals:

  • Help yourself breakfast
  • Packed lunch
  • Home cooked meal in the evening. If your family goes out for dinner you must include the athlete in your arrangements & pay for their evening meal
  • If the athlete wishes to go out with friends, any meals will be at the athlete's expense.

Transport

  • The athlete is responsible for organising transport to & from training venues & any venue at which they are studying outside of training
  • If homestay family is asked to provide transport on a one-off or on regular occasions, additional compensation & limitations will need to be agreed on by the athlete & homestay family.

Training

  • HPC will advise details of training & any events to the homestay family using Facebook, Twitter & email as per info pack
  • Your coach will maintain regular contact with you regarding your athlete’s training commitments

Telephones

  • All overseas calls by the athlete should be made collect or by using pre-paid 0800 phone cards
  • Athletes are responsible for paying any phone expenses incurred in the household directly to the homestay family. Cardrona HPC accepts no responsibility for any athlete-incurred expenses

Heating & electricity

  • Most of our athletes come from countries that have air conditioning as a common feature & are not used to the colder houses in New Zealand. They have been informed of how heating & electricity works here, however we ask that you please allow them to feel warm & comfortable in your home

Emergencies

  • If your athlete needs medical attention, they should be taken to your own doctor or nearest medical centre
  • In any type of emergency, please contact the Homestay Coordinator & advise of the situation

Homestay payments

  • Payments will be made as arranged between you & the athlete either weekly, fortnightly or lump sum

Homestay check

  • After you apply, the Homestay Coordinator will contact you to arrange a time to visit you & check that your home is suitable for a homestay situation

Expectations

We require all families to treat athletes with respect & kindness. It is important to us that the athlete feels comfortable & safe with your family.

Your rules & guidelines for the athlete should, within reason, be based around what they are accustomed to at home & should be discussed with the athlete & the athlete’s family, so that they fully understand your expectations & you understand the needs of the athlete.

You will be required to agree to a Police Vetting Check on all people living in the house who are 18 years or over.
